Output e43afdc8aed95fa1b2d23e078cf332f108c89329d9bda3773e247e18d56dbedf:2

value
189162
script pubkey
OP_0 OP_PUSHBYTES_20 3d59c7bcde7f8d5d0fc4b1f5e6477fac8b2e9807
address
bc1q84vu00x707x46r7yk867v3ml4j9jaxq8knaut8
transaction
e43afdc8aed95fa1b2d23e078cf332f108c89329d9bda3773e247e18d56dbedf